Former opener Gautam Gambhir believes that batting great Rahul Dravid is the country's most "under-rated" captain, who never got enough credit for his contribution to the game in India despite making an impact comparable to only Sachin Tendulkar. Dravid captained India in 79 ODIs, winning 42 of them, which includes the world record of 14 successive wins while chasing. The 47-year-old also led India's Test team to some impressive results in away series in West Indies, South Africa, Bangladesh and England.

Having already assured a quarter-final berth, Indian team will be aiming to top their pool when they square off against a spirited Nepal in the final group league encounter of the ICC U-19 World Cup, on Monday. Rahul Dravid's boys have steamrolled their earlier opponents beating Ireland by 79 runs and New Zealand by a whopping 120-run margin. With Nepal also having qualified for the quarterfinals, tomorrow's match will decide which team will top Group D. The group champion will face either Namibia or Bangladesh in the quarter-final after defending champions South Africa crashed out on Sunday. On paper, an India versus Nepal cricketing contest should have been declared as a mismatch but the teenagers from the Himalayan nation have been the 'surprise package' of the tournament so far, defeating New Zealand and Ireland with minimum fuss.

Sachin Tendulkar compiled a mountain of runs for almost a quarter of a century and reached cricket's dizzying heights by defying a burden of expectation that would have crushed lesser mortals. Whenever Tendulkar came to the crease, India's billion-plus population made secret deals with gods, froze where they were, clutched lucky charms and indulged in all sorts of superstitions. And the sport's most prolific run-accumulator created plenty of those heart-in-mouth moments in his 24 years in international cricket.
